Programmed Trading Strategies

For many investors, the concept of automated trading strategies can seem shrouded in mystery. However, these strategies simply involve utilizing computer programs to execute trades based on predefined rules and parameters. By removing emotion from the equation, automated trading aims to enhance returns while minimizing risk.

There are diverse types of automated trading strategies available, each with its own distinct approach to market analysis and trade execution. Some popular examples include trend-following strategies, mean reversion strategies, and arbitrage strategies.

  • Understanding the mechanics of automated trading can empower investors to make more informed decisions about their investment portfolios.
  • By leveraging sophisticated algorithms, these strategies can scan vast amounts of market data and identify profitable avenues that may be missed by human traders.

In spite of the potential benefits, it's crucial to approach automated trading with caution. Thorough research, diligent backtesting, and a well-defined risk management plan are essential for success in this dynamic and ever-evolving market landscape.

Backtesting and Optimization for Automated Trading

Before diving into the live markets with an automated trading system, rigorous backtesting is paramount. This process involves testing your strategy on historical data to assess its success in various market conditions. By meticulously analyzing the results, you can highlight strengths and weaknesses, ultimately leading to optimization. Optimization aims to refine your system's parameters, such as risk management, to maximize its yield while minimizing drawdowns. A well-configured strategy will demonstrate consistent success even in changing market environments.

  • Additionally, it's crucial to conduct thorough position sizing analysis during backtesting to ensure your system can withstand market fluctuations.
  • In conclusion, the combination of robust backtesting and continuous optimization is essential for developing profitable and sustainable automated trading strategies.
